Anthropic’s Claude models are known for exceptional reasoning capabilities, nuanced understanding, and industry-leading context windows up to 200,000 tokens.

Available models

Claude 3.5 Sonnet

Context: 200K tokens
Strengths: Best balance, reasoning, coding
Anthropic’s most capable general-purpose model

Claude 3.5 Haiku

Context: 200K tokens
Strengths: Speed, efficiency, large context
Fast responses with extended context

Claude 3 Opus

Context: 200K tokens
Strengths: Maximum capability, analysis
Top-tier performance for complex tasks
